Surge in self-injury cases

Published: 26 June 2007
International experts who gathered at McGill this week report an extraordinary surge in cases of non-suicidal self-injury by teenagers, apparently seeking release from the emotional distress of a detached world that is moving too fast and demanding too much. "Some people refer to it as the new anorexia," Nancy Heath, a professor in McGill's department of educational psychology, told the Gazette.
